Customer Due Diligence (CDD)
To help prevent financial crime, we may conduct Customer Due Diligence (“CDD”) before completing a transaction.
Customers may be required to provide:
Identity Verification
- Full legal name
- Date of birth
- Residential address
- Government-issued photo identification
Proof of Address
A document dated within the previous three months, including:
- Utility bill
- Bank statement
- Council tax statement
- Government correspondence
Biometric Verification
Where appropriate, customers may be required to provide a live selfie or facial verification image.
Identity Verification Provider
Balloch & Co uses Sumsub to assist with identity verification and fraud prevention procedures.
Sumsub may be used to:
- Verify identity documents
- Validate customer identity
- Detect document fraud
- Perform biometric verification
- Support compliance and risk assessments
Verification may be required before a transaction is approved.
Enhanced Due Diligence (EDD)
In higher-risk situations, Balloch & Co may conduct Enhanced Due Diligence.
Additional information may be requested, including:
- Source of funds
- Source of wealth
- Additional identification documents
- Information regarding the purpose of the transaction
- Supporting documentation relating to ownership of a watch
EDD may be applied where:
- Transaction values are significant
- Unusual transaction patterns are detected
- Higher-risk jurisdictions are involved
- Additional risk indicators are identified
Transaction Monitoring
We monitor transactions and customer activity for indicators of suspicious behaviour, including:
- Unusual payment patterns
- Multiple linked transactions
- Inconsistent customer information
- Requests involving third parties without clear justification
- Attempts to avoid verification requirements
- Transactions that appear inconsistent with the customer’s profile
Where concerns arise, transactions may be delayed while further reviews are conducted.

Source of Funds
For certain transactions, Balloch & Co may request evidence demonstrating the legitimate source of funds used for a purchase.
Examples may include:
- Bank statements
- Proof of salary or employment
- Sale agreements
- Inheritance documentation
- Business income records
Failure to provide satisfactory evidence may result in cancellation of the transaction.
Suspicious Activity
Where suspicious activity is identified, Balloch & Co may:
- Suspend the transaction
- Request additional information
- Conduct further compliance checks
- Decline the transaction
- Take any action required by applicable law
We may not be permitted to disclose the reasons for certain compliance-related decisions.
